Godhra riots:Setback for Modi as SC restrains Special Court

NEW DELHI, Jan 17:
The Supreme Court today restrained the special court Ahmedabad from delivering the final order on the SIT report exonerating Gujarat Chief Minister Narendra Modi for his role during 2002 Godhra riots.
A bench comprising Justices D K Jain, P Sathasivam and Aftab Alam passed the order while hearing the application of Zakia Jafri, widow of slain Congress MP Ehsan Zafri who has challenged the trial court order dismissing her application for supply of the copy of the SIT report.
The SIT headed by former CBI director Mr Raghavan has given a clean chit to the Gujarat CM.
The apex court today directed the Ahmedabad special court not to pass the final order in the matter till the application of Zakia is decided by this court. (UNI)
